Skip to main content

MariaDB

Uno de los elementos importantes de un entorno son las bases de datos (BBDD). Es donde se almacenan los datos necesarios para que las aplicaciones puedan guardar y gestionar persistentemente en el disco.

AquíHabitualmente, explicocuando cómocreo tengoun montadoDocker MariaDB,de motor de BBDD, añado también un gestor gráfico o tipo web para agilizar la gestión de la misma. Así que esen uneste forkcaso dehe MySQLañadido ElphpMyAdmin.

motivo
---
deservices:
  dichomariadb:
    forkcontainer_name: esmariadb
    queimage: MySQLmariadb
    fuerestart: compradaalways
    pornetworks:
      Oracle,- ymariadbnet
    asívolumes:
     se- conseguía/home/lynze/mariadb:/var/lib/mysql
    tenerenvironment:
      unaMYSQL_ROOT_PASSWORD: base${DATABASE_PWD}
              
  dephpmyadmin:
    datosimage: (BD)phpmyadmin
    Opencontainer_name: Source,phpmyadmin
    perorestart: ahoraalways
    resultadepends_on:
      que- MariaDBmariadb
    tambiénnetworks:
      ha- sidomariadbnet
    comprada,ports:
      por- lo"80:80"
    queenvironment:
      no- PMA_HOST=mariadb

yonetworks:
  quémariadbnet:
    nosexternal: quedará al final.

true